This sprawling metropolis is the seat of the Bollywood film industry.Here we present to you a list of top 10 haunted places in Maharashtra.  1) D`Souza Chawl (Mumbai)  A well in the D`souza Chawl area of Mumbai, Mahim has acquired the reputation of being haunted. It is said that a woman, while getting water, fell to her death in the well. Many people claim to have seen the ghostly apparition of that woman near the well.  2) Vrindavan Society (Thane)  It is said that a man had committed suicide in one of the buildings in Vrindavan Society. The security guards patrolling the area have encountered strange things and happenings since then.
